Raspberry Coconut Layer Bars Recipe

Ingredients:

1 2/3 c graham cracker crumbs
1/2 cup butter, melted
2 2/3 cup shredded coconut
1 - 14 oz can sweetened condensed milk
1 cup raspberry jam or preserves
1/3 cup finely chopped nuts, toasted

Directions:

Combine graham cracker crumbs and butter in a med bowl. Spread evenly over bottom of 9x13 baking dish, press firmly

Sprinkle with coconut; pour condensed milk evenly over coconut.
Bake in preheated 350º oven for 20-25 minutes, or until lightly browned, cool 15 minutes

Spread raspberry jam over coconut layer; chill for 3-4 hours or until firm.
Sprinkle with nuts
Cu into 3x1 1/2" bars.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
24
